Our Tastes-- Sweetwater Squeeze Box

Squeeze Box IPA, is my continuation into all things grapefruit. I've delved into Sculpin of course, SA's version, Tropicanon, Citrus Mistress, made my own GIPA, even HI-5 had some to it. Pouring a more particulate beer than I am accustomed to from SW and a darkened yellow with good white foam. Nose is a gentle aroma of sweet grapefruit pulp, but the taste yields a dichotomous pithy bitter. Oddly, this is only the second beer that I've seen that uses Midnight Wheat. That's a new grain for me, I need to do some reading up. Overall, this is a great "unseasonal" (much like our last 2 winters!). 6.1%abv and fully crushable.

Brew Batch #77 Centennial IPA (cIPA)

Having sorted through the aforementioned hop inventory, I deduced a nice straight Centennial IPA would be warranted. So I dusted off a basic IPA recipe and when all is said and done, I'll have 6oz of hops in it. I'll be replicating the 10 minute hop stand from The Medusa batch because it seemed to bring the aroma of the hop out so well. I'm also using Pac-Man yeast (Wyeast 1764) from Rogue for the first time, we'll see if it's as bad as John Maier says it is. OG 1.064+0.001 @66F. What better beer to brew on Inauguration Day. Our Tastes-- Heady Topper

Got a chance to have a beer I've heard about for a long time but unfortunately never had the opportunity to grab one without breaking the bank! It says, "Drink from the can." and yet I partook from a large tulip that accentuated the hazy medium straw color. Smell for me was a touch citrus but taste ended on a grassy, dankness that is extremely memorable. Very smooth and velvety on the mouth feel. It is not Pliny, BUT in it's own right a superbly delicious 8% 100 IBU DIPA that I would drink all day, not could but would;) Upper 90s-100 on ratings, I'm glad I'll die with a little part of this one in me.
